调亏滴灌对土壤水盐分布与河套蜜瓜产量的影响

研究不同生育期调亏及亏缺程度对土壤水盐分布和河套蜜瓜产量的影响。采用田间滴灌试验,分别在蜜瓜伸蔓期和结果期进行20%、30%和40%灌水量亏缺处理。试验结果表明:充分灌溉处理(T1)的土壤剖面含水率随时间波动最为剧烈,伸蔓期和结果期亏缺处理的土壤剖面含水率平均极差分别比T1低48.5%和80%。各处理的土壤剖面盐渍度随时间均有增长趋势,T1的土壤剖面平均电导率在生育期前后的增幅为0.026ds/m,亏缺灌溉处理的增幅为0.073~0.098ds/m。伸蔓期和结果期亏缺处理的产量平均值分别比充分灌溉处理显著降低16.0%和20.5%,但2个时期亏缺处理的产量之间不存在显著性差异。伸蔓期亏缺处理的平均灌溉水利用效率比T1低11.6%,而结果期亏缺处理比T1高6.5%。在结果期亏缺处理中,进行30%灌水量亏缺的T7产量最高,并与伸蔓期各亏缺处理相对于T1的减产幅度相差不大,但灌水量比T1低25.0%,灌溉水利用效率比T1高9.0%。因此,为取得较好的节水效应和灌溉水利用效率,T7是滴灌条件下河套蜜瓜覆膜起垄种植的最佳选择。 The effects of different deficit periods and deficit in different growth stages on the distribution of soil water and salt and the yield of honeydew melon in Hetao were studied. Field drip irrigation experiments were conducted to deal with the deficits of 20%, 30% and 40% of the irrigation amount during the flowering and fruiting stages of honeydew. The results showed that the moisture content of soil profiles in fully irrigated condition (T1) fluctuated the most intensely with time, and the mean range of soil profile moisture content in extensile and fruiting stages was 48.5% and 80% lower than T1 respectively. The salinity of soil profile increased with time. The average conductivity of soil profile in T1 increased 0.026ds / m before and after the growth period, and the increase of deficit irrigation was 0.073 ~ 0.098ds / m. The mean yields of stretch and fruiting phases decreased significantly by 16.0% and 20.5%, respectively, compared with those under full irrigation, but there was no significant difference between the two treatments. The average irrigation water use efficiency in deficit treatment was 11.6% lower than that in T1, while the deficit treatment in the result period was 6.5% higher than T1. In the treatment of the deficit period, the yield of T7 with 30% irrigation deficit was the highest, and it was not different from that of T1 with the deficit treatment in stretch manure period, but the irrigation amount was 25.0% lower than T1. The irrigation water Use efficiency higher than T1 9.0%. Therefore, in order to obtain better water-saving effect and utilization efficiency of irrigation water, T7 is the best choice for drip irrigation under the conditions of drip irrigation.
